is determined by employment status Job Summary/Description The
Detroit Medical Center (DMC) Registered Nurse (RN) is a member of
the Patient Care Services Team, and is responsible for the
satisfactory completion of nursing care by the nursing team. The RN
manages and provides patient care activities for a group of
patients and their families through application of independent
judgment, communication and collaboration with all team members
including ancillary and support services. The role of the
Registered Nurse at the DMC encompasses leadership, partnership,
collaboration, teaching and supervision. The DMC RN: • Establishes
and maintains collaborative relationships with physicians and other
health care providers • Delegates, assesses, provides and evaluates
patient care • Provides and delegates patient care activities to
team members • Monitors patient progress and prepares patient for
discharge • Reports directly to senior unit management and
participates in shared decision-making activities Minimum
Qualifications 1. Graduation from a school of nursing required. 2.
BSN preferred. 3. Licensed to practice as a Registered Nurse (RN)
in the state of Michigan required. 4. American Heart Association
(AHA) BLS required. Facility Description: DMC Harper University
